1. TradeGecko
TradeGecko is a cloud-based inventory management system that is popular among small and medium-sized businesses. This system offers features such as inventory tracking, order management, and reporting. TradeGecko also integrates with popular e-commerce platforms like Shopify and WooCommerce, making it easy to manage inventory across multiple sales channels.
2. Fishbowl
Fishbowl is a comprehensive inventory management system that is particularly well-suited for manufacturers and wholesalers. With features such as multi-location tracking, barcode scanning, and demand forecasting, Fishbowl helps businesses efficiently manage their inventory and streamline their operations. Fishbowl also integrates with popular accounting software like QuickBooks, making it easy to keep track of inventory costs and profitability.
3. NetSuite
NetSuite is a cloud-based inventory management system that is designed for larger businesses with complex inventory needs. NetSuite offers features such as demand planning, supply chain management, and real-time reporting. This system also integrates with other business software modules such as customer relationship management (CRM) and finance, providing a comprehensive solution for businesses looking to streamline their operations.

5. Zoho Inventory
Zoho Inventory is a cloud-based inventory management system that is popular among small businesses and startups. Zoho Inventory offers features such as real-time tracking, inventory optimization, and multichannel selling. This system also integrates with other Zoho business software modules like CRM and accounting, providing a seamless solution for businesses looking to streamline their operations.
6. Cin7
Cin7 is a cloud-based inventory management system that is designed for businesses with complex inventory needs. Cin7 offers features such as multi-location tracking, barcode scanning, and demand planning. This system also integrates with popular e-commerce platforms like Shopify and WooCommerce, making it easy to manage inventory across multiple sales channels.
7. inFlow Inventory
inFlow Inventory is a desktop-based inventory management system that is popular among small businesses and independent retailers. inFlow Inventory offers features such as inventory tracking, order management, and reporting. This system is easy to use and can be customized to fit the specific needs of your business.
